Fish Tales is a cute little game that has relaxing music (or at least, in my opinion). One of the best things is, you get to eat fish that are littler than you are. But beware, stay away from those whoppers that aren’t so small, because they’ll eat you (which won’t be so good for your frustration)! This game is fun but the only bad thing is, it’ll take a long time to complete and you can’t save it.
Okay, okay, this game is so far from soothing, it can actually be downright stressful at times. But Noah’s Ark is still a very fun game and if you’re just trying to have a good time and take a break from your blogging or your work, then it’s a good one. One of my favorites. :)
Pirate’s Booty is a game that makes you think. Your goal is to dig up treasure. It has a simple concept and is like Minesweeper that comes on Windows computers. It can get annoying when you mess up or lose, but it’s one you might just want to keep playing over and over.
